Are you an experienced Van Driver or Flat Bed Driver looking for a long-term opportunity with the potential to become permanent?

GM Recruitment, a specialist construction recruitment agency, is recruiting on behalf of one of our established construction clients in London.

This is an excellent opportunity to join a busy, professional team, with the successful candidate offered a permanent position following a successful temporary probation period.

We're looking for a reliable, hardworking driver who takes pride in their work, has a strong awareness of health and safety, and enjoys working as part of a team supporting construction projects across London and the surrounding areas.

Role

You’ll play an important part in keeping construction projects running smoothly by transporting materials, equipment and waste safely and efficiently between sites.

Responsibilities

  • Carrying out daily vehicle safety checks and reporting any defects.
  • Delivering and offloading materials to construction sites.
  • Collecting, transporting and disposing of waste materials where required.
  • Ensuring all loads are safe and secure before transport.
  • Maintaining accurate records of deliveries, duties and stock movements.
  • Monitoring the location and condition of plant and equipment.
  • Working closely with site managers and colleagues to meet operational requirements.
  • Following all Health & Safety and environmental procedures.
  • Undertaking any other reasonable driving duties as required.

Essential Requirements

  • Full & clean UK driving licence (Category B or C1).
  • Valid CSCS card.
  • Good understanding of Health & Safety within a construction environment.
  • Strong communication and organisational skills.
  • Reliable, punctual and able to work independently.
  • Positive attitude and strong work ethic.

Desirable

  • Experience delivering to construction sites.
  • Knowledge of plant and material handling.
